Output 33b5ba09c0d669328cce11c15594f1aa109a9474059ddf4592919697f5fd4203:14

value
20077743
script pubkey
OP_0 OP_PUSHBYTES_20 e9fb4cb216d6d2055b47c7cf155ef60d81b3bcb3
address
bc1qa8a5evsk6mfq2k68cl832hhkpkqm809n6vzwrd
transaction
33b5ba09c0d669328cce11c15594f1aa109a9474059ddf4592919697f5fd4203
spent
true